Immigration agent shoots at suspect during operation in South L.A.

*. Federal agents fired “defensive shots” at a suspect accused of ramming his car into law enforcement while attempting to flee an immigration operation.

*. The man was not injured and crashed his car in Willowbrook where he was taken into custody.
“It feels reckless,” said neighbor Miguel Carrillo. “There’s kids who walk to school here.”

*. A federal immigration agent shot at a suspect during a targeted operation in South L.A. on Wednesday morning, drawing a crowd of protesters to the shut-down street and intensifying safety concerns in the immigrant heavy community.


By Ruben Vives, Clara Harter and Brittny Mejia
Los Angeles Times, January 21, 2026

A federal agent opened fire at a man after he rammed federal law enforcement with his vehicle while attempting to evade arrest during an immigration operation in Compton, according to the Department of Homeland Security. The man was not wounded, but a U.S. Customs and Border Protection agent sustained unspecified injuries.

A federal agent opened fire at a man after he rammed federal law enforcement with his vehicle while attempting to evade arrest during an immigration operation in Compton, according to the Department of Homeland Security. The man was not wounded, but a U.S. Customs and Border Protection agent sustained unspecified injuries.

At 7:05 a.m., Homeland Security officers conducted an operation to apprehend William Eduardo Moran Carballo, a citizen of El Salvador who is accused of being in the U.S. illegally and “participating in a human smuggling operation,” according to a department spokesperson.

A federal agent walks past a bullet shattered window of a car involved in a shooting in Willowbrook.

In an attempt to flee, Carballo “weaponized his vehicle” and rammed law enforcement, who fired at Carballo in defense, the spokesperson said.

Key payout structure: ( as per MS Copilot search )

Total amount: Advertised as up to $50,000, depending on position, location, and hiring authority.

Payment schedule: The bonus is split over three years, not paid all at once.

Retention requirement: Each installment is contingent on the employee remaining in good standing and completing required service periods.

Position‑specific terms: Exact installment amounts and timing can vary by role (e.g., Deportation Officer vs. special agent) and hiring announcement.
